Overview

Program Dates:

Winter:
January through April

Fall:
September through December

This is an exciting opportunity to learn how Automation Testing helps enterprise organizations design, develop, and deliver quality software! You will work with talented team members who want to share their experiences, provide mentorship, and actively participate in improving automation  will work in a fast paced environment and gain experience about how enterprise platforms are built. You will contribute as part of a full-stack development team that does it all: front-end, back-end, database, Dev Ops, and test automation and work with the latest tools and technologies in the .NET

ecosystem:
Azure Dev Ops, C#,  Core (including ASP).

Responsibilities

  • Automate client and server-side applications, testing mobile and web platforms
  • Learn, maintain, design, create, improve:
  • C# NET Core web apps and APIs
  • Azure Dev Ops CI/CD pipelines and tools
  • Automated UI and API test suites
  • Databases
  • Participate in developing solutions to problems
  • Plan and implement work under the guidance of a mentor
  • Work closely with the development manager to meet assigned development goals

Qualifications

  • Preference given to students currently in their junior or senior year of college, pursuing a degree in related field
  • Able to work in Idaho Falls, Idaho for your program dates of approximately 90 days
  • Cumulative GPA of 3.75 or higher
  • Passion for learning automation testing and CI/CD
  • Knowledge of object-oriented development
  • Knowledge of C#, ASP.NET or Microsoft SQL preferred
  • Familiarity with Cypress is a plus
